#800e11 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#800e11 is composed of 50.2% red, 5.5%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 27.8%. #800e11 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c22 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#800e11 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#800e11 has RGB values of R:128, G:14,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.87,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8392209.

Shades and Tints of #800e11
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#800e11
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494545 is the less saturated color, while #8b0307 is the most saturated one.
